Among one of the most visible examples of injection molding in the lorry industry is the Auto Lamp Mold. Automotive lights is no more practically illumination. Headlamps, tail lights, fog lights, and signal lights are currently essential styling components that contribute to brand name identity and automobile safety and security. The lens shapes, reflector surface areas, and real estate structures have to be produced with severe precision due to the fact that even a little flaw can influence light distribution, sturdiness, or the total appearance of the lorry. An Auto Lamp Mold should for that reason be made to manage fine optical details, smooth surface area finishes, and consistent dimensional accuracy. It additionally needs to sustain products that can stand up to warm from leds or bulbs, exposure to weather, and long-term UV effects. As automotive lighting continues to evolve toward thinner, more attractive, and a lot more technically sophisticated styles, the mold itself must also end up being more advanced. This is where proficient mold engineering, mindful material selection, and progressed machining all come together to supply trustworthy lighting parts that satisfy both visual and practical needs.
The importance of a Two-shot Mold in automotive manufacturing has also grown significantly as vehicles come to be extra feature-rich and refined. A Two-shot Mold allows the molding of two various products or colors in one manufacturing procedure, which is particularly beneficial for parts that need a mix of gentleness and rigidness, or aesthetic contrast and performance. In automotive interiors, this procedure can be utilized to create buttons, handles, holds, light overviews, ornamental trims, and control parts with incorporated soft-touch surface areas or contrasting style aspects. Sometimes, it enables makers to get rid of secondary assembly actions, lower labor, and improve bonding between products. The result is a more seamless and sturdy end product that supports greater high quality standards. For automotive exterior components, a Two-shot Mold can assist create elements with enhanced climate resistance, improved responsive features, or aesthetically appealing accents that add to a costs look. Due to the fact that the molding cycle combines numerous materials in a controlled procedure, it likewise improves performance and uniformity, which is particularly valuable when huge manufacturing volumes are required.
In the broader context of automobile production, Automotive Interior & Exterior Trim Mold options are among one of the most important tools for forming the consumer's perception of high quality. Interior trim includes control panels, facility consoles, door panels, column covers, air vent elements, seatback trims, and many decorative or useful surface areas. Exterior trim may include grilles, moldings, manages, column garnishes, wheel arch accents, and other aspects that affect the lorry's visual character. These parts may seem small contrasted with the engine or chassis, but they are the surfaces individuals see and touch frequently. If a trim piece has poor fit, unequal structure, noticeable sink marks, or shade inconsistency, the whole vehicle can feel much less costs. That is why Automotive Interior & Exterior Trim Mold style have to represent look, longevity, setting up efficiency, and material actions all at once. Interior items commonly need soft-touch finishes, reduced odor products, and resistance to scratches and cleaning chemicals. Exterior trim demands UV stability, influence resistance, and weather condition endurance. In both cases, the mold needs to recreate great textures, sharp sides, and complex geometries consistently over lengthy production runs.
Plastic Injection Mold innovation is particularly well matched to the demands of automotive trim due to the fact that it offers repeatability and adaptability in component layout. A durable Plastic Injection Mold can generate components with ribs, employers, clips, living joints, and integrated installing features that decrease the need for secondary operations or added fasteners. Since the automotive market is extremely competitive, manufacturers are frequently looking for methods to enhance part top quality while reducing cost and cycle time, and Plastic Injection Mold systems are central to accomplishing both objectives.
Designing molds for automotive applications needs even more than standard tooling knowledge. It demands an understanding of part feature, product performance, cooling efficiency, venting, entrance positioning, warpage, production, and contraction security. An Auto Lamp Mold have to often support transparent or transparent materials that are very sensitive to surface issues and flow marks. Any kind of defect in the dental caries surface might appear plainly in the finished lens. A Two-shot Mold includes another layer of intricacy due to the fact that the interface in between products should be very carefully managed to make sure excellent adhesion and exact alignment. Automotive Interior & Exterior Trim Mold jobs usually involve big surface areas or highly visible areas, which means even minor flaws can be inappropriate. A Plastic Injection Mold made use of for high-volume automobile components should be durable enough to hold up against duplicated cycles and preserve precision over time. This is why mold manufacturers buy advanced CNC machining, EDM processes, surface area polishing, simulation software, and quality assurance systems to make sure every detail is correct prior to automation begins.
